Comenius

Comenius, previously an action under The Socrates Programme, aims to develop knowledge and understanding amongst young people and educators of the European diversity present in cultures, languages and in its values. It also encourages young people to acquire the basic life-skills and competences necessary for their personal development, for future employment and for an active European citizenship.

 

Comenius focuses on the initial stages of education, from pre-school and primary to secondary school. It tries to address all members of the education community –  not only pupils, teachers, other education staff, but also local authorities, parents' associations & non-government organisations. This measure supports school partnerships, individual mobility of teachers and student teachers, projects for the training of school education staff, and school education networks. It thus aims to enhance the quality of teaching, strengthen its European dimension and promote language learning and mobility. This measure stresses the importance of the following themes for a better Europe: learning in a multi-cultural framework, which is the cornerstone of European citizenship, support for disadvantaged groups, countering under-achievement at school and preventing exclusion.

 

 

Operational objectives

  • To improve the quality and to increase the volume of mobility involving pupils and educational staff in different Member States
  • To improve the quality and to increase the volume of partnerships between schools in different Member States
  • To encourage the learning of modern foreign languages
  • To support the development of innovative ICT-based content, services, pedagogies and practice in lifelong learning
  • To enhance the quality and European dimension of teacher training and support improvements in pedagogical approaches and school management

 

For whom is this Measure targeted?

 

This Measure is targeted for:

  • Pupils in school education up to the end of upper secondary education
  • Schools
  • Teachers and other staff within schools
  • Associations, NGOs and representatives of those involved in school education, persons
  • Bodies responsible for the organisation and delivery of education at local, regional and national levels
  • Higher education institutions
  • Bodies providing guidance, counseling and information services
